Ontario U-16 Boys Defeat Alberta 3-1 And Win Silver

BROSSARD, QC, Sunday, July 27, 2008 — The Ontario U-16 Boys prevailed 3-1 over Alberta in their final match of the 2008 BMO National All-Star Championships. Ontario goals were scored in the well-played match by #7 Jonathan Lao, #9 Allando Matheson and #17 Daniel Calabretta. Congratulations to the U-16 Ontario All-Stars for their Silver Medal more »
